Reproductive Health Care
Planned Parenthood is a well-known group dedicated to providing vital reproductive health care services. Hundreds of thousands of people rely on Planned Parenthood for assistance with family planning, sexual health services, and health checkups. Their commitment to making healthcare accessible ensures that everyone has the opportunity to take control of their reproductive health.
